Transaction 71a889019c0a137f18e9336115137541dd34939e791e592709fac3357ab90935

1 Input
2 Outputs
  • 71a889019c0a137f18e9336115137541dd34939e791e592709fac3357ab90935:0
  • value  17143
    address  1Ff2CkvNRFPDs9YSB2dCxZ25FGftsMiE9J
  • 71a889019c0a137f18e9336115137541dd34939e791e592709fac3357ab90935:1
  • value  18490491
    address  3339TurHReQU8qLk8T3QG5S25QQetRqmTK